Numerical Optimization of the Ship Hull from a Hydrodynamic Standpoint

The numerical procedure for an optimization of a ship hull from a hydrodynamic standpoint is presented in the paper. In the procedure, a potential flow solver coupled with the genetic algorithm has been used. As an objective function, the wave resistance has been chosen. The optimization procedure has been applied for the Series 60 (CB=0.60) hull taken as reference hull. Depending on imposed geometrical constraints, several variations of the ship forebody have been obtained. The results from the numerical predictions indicate that the obtained hull forms yield a reduction in wave resistance.
